Rep. Schrier to Hold Health Care Affordability Town Hall in Issaquah on Tuesday

Congresswoman Kim Schrier, M.D. (WA-08) will be joined by House Democratic Caucus Chair Congressman Hakeem Jeffries (NY-08) for a Health Care Affordability Town Hall on Tuesday, February 18, 2020. The event will be held at 12:15 p.m. at the Issaquah Senior Center, 75 NE Creek Way, Issaquah, WA.

In 2019, House Democrats passed several bills to bring down the cost of health care and prescription drugs, including the Lower Drug Costs Now Act, which will allow Medicare to negotiate prices of the most expensive drugs it covers. The House also passed Rep. Schrier’s bill, the Medicare Vision Act, which will require Medicare Part B to cover routine vision exams and eyeglasses prescriptions. Lastly, Rep. Schrier’s bill, the Protecting Access to Biosimilars Act, was signed into law as part of the end of year spending package. This legislation will make it easier for less expensive biologic drugs, like insulin, to get to market. All of these bills and issues will be discussed at the Town Hall.
